Association LinkedIn Pages: Best Practices

LinkedIn is the world’s largest professional network with over 562 million users in more than 200 countries. It is a powerful tool, especially for associations who want to reach members, legislators, journalists, and prospects. With persistence, associations can benefit from utilizing this platform to bring better visibility to their organization. September Social Media Ideas for Associations

Holiday observances are a great way to keep your association’s social media feeds active. Talk Like a Pirate Day, Truck Driver Appreciation Week, and Service Dog Month are just a few September holidays.
